What they do
A Contracts Analyst reviews business contracts for a company or organization. Reviews proposed contract terms and conditions, communicates with management about contract obligations, and communicates and negotiates with clients. Prepares contract cost estimates and reviews proposals for contract changes. Confirms that contract terms have been met before a contract is closed out.

Job Description The Office of Sponsored Programs (OSP) is a division of the Office of the Vice President for Research and Innovation at Virginia Tech. OSP provides a comprehensive array of administrative support services to the university to help faculty and staff obtain and manage grants and contracts from external sponsors who provide the funding for the university's research projects. OSP functions as a steward of Virginia Tech's research portfolio and is responsible for ensuring that all research proposals and projects comply with federal and state laws and regulations, the sponsor's policies and terms and conditions, and university policies and procedures. The Contracts Support Specialist is an integral part of a dedicated team of professionals working to ensure that obligations for sponsored programs align with federal, state, university regulations, and the sponsor's requirements. The Contracts Support Specialist assists faculty and the Office of Sponsored Programs in the preparation of documents and materials that facilitate research agreements and requests, including contracts, grants, subawards and award change requests. The Contracts Support Specialist organizes large volumes of information and works closely with others in the office to deliver consistent results to internal and external stakeholders, while also displaying a high level of professionalism and customer service. The Contracts Support Specialist performs effectively and with limited supervision in a fast-moving environment.
